This is a medium-length story dataset introduced in **LongStory: Coherent, Complete and Length Controlled Long story Generation** : [https://arxiv.org/abs/2311.15208](https://arxiv.org/abs/2311.15208). |
|
|
|
|
|
The dataset was collected by the authors from Reedsy Prompts : [https://blog.reedsy.com/short-stories/](https://blog.reedsy.com/short-stories/), as of May 2023. |
|
|
|
|
|
In the original paper, the authors use a 60k/4k/4k train/validation/test split. |
|
|
|
|
|
For comparison: |
|
|
- **WritingPrompts** (Fan et al., 2018): ~768 tokens per story |
|
|
- **Booksum** (Kryściński et al., 2021): ~6,065 tokens per story |
|
|
- **BookCorpus** (Project Gutenberg): ~90,000 words per story (approx.) |
|
|
|
|
|
- (ours) **ReedsyPrompts** : ~2426 tokens per story |

Use this : |
|
|
<pre><code> |
|
|
from datasets import load_dataset |
|
|
ds = load_dataset("Iyan/reedsyPrompts") |
|
|
print(ds["train"][0]['index']) |
|
|
print(ds["train"][0]['prompt']) # the prompt of the story |
|
|
print(ds["train"][0]['name']) # the title of the story |
|
|
print(ds["train"][0]['story']) |
|
|
|
|
|
</code></pre> |
